Key Features That Redefine Small Spaces
This isn’t just a metal box – it’s engineered living. The unit features:
– Rapid Deployment: Unfolds in under 30 minutes with zero foundation work (video proof below!)
– Smart Insulation: Rockwool and EPS foam keep interiors comfortable in -20°C to 50°C climates
– Off-Grid Ready: Pre-installed solar mounts, rainwater harvesting ports, and composting toilet options
– Premium Finishes: Bamboo flooring, LED lighting, and full kitchenette with induction cooktop

When expanded, the 10ft unit reveals a surprisingly roomy 200 sq ft layout. The bedroom area features a Murphy bed that folds into the wall, converting to a workspace by day. The bathroom includes a full shower with water-saving fixtures – a luxury rarely found in container home 20ft base models at this price point.

How It Compares to Container Home 20ft Models
While container home 20ft units offer more static space, the 10ft expandable wins in:
– Mobility: Tows behind standard trucks (20ft requires special permits)
– Zoning Flexibility: Often classified as “temporary structure” in restrictive areas
– Scalability: Link multiple units for custom layouts
– Resale Value: Higher demand in tiny home markets
